Standard Features
The SAM 12
aspirator is a top quality surgical suction unit designed to be highly
adaptable. The SAM 12 is a high
flow,
high vacuum
unit ideal for use in general wards, accident and emergency, minor
operating theatres, intensive care and also as a backup unit for hospitals and
dentistry clinics. Its reputation for reliability and ease of operation has
established it among the most widely used units in the medical world today.
As standard, the SAM 12 incorporates an
autoclavable SAM 2 collection vessel fitted with a float valve system, providing
automatic shut-off to avoid over-flow.
The SAM 12 is also available with a choice of
disposable collection systems including Serres, Abbott, VacSax and Pennine.
Other disposable collection systems can be
fitted to the SAM 12 on request.
The unit incorporates an MQ25 oil free
diaphragm vacuum pump that requires minimal maintenance and helps prevent cross
contamination. The MQ25 also benefits from an enclosed crankcase for quiet
operation, IP44 totally enclosed fan cooled (TEFC) permanent capacitor motor
with long life sealed bearings and thermal protection.
The SAM 12 has multiple safety features
including overflow control valves and an internal hydrophobic filter to minimise
the risk of contamination.
The unit is fitted with a bacterial filter
externally but will be provided with a hydrophobic filter if required.
Technical Information
| Voltage |
230v +/- 10% ~
50/60Hz
110v +/- 5% ~ 50/60Hz |
|
Vacuum |
0 to 0.85 bar / 0 to 650 mmHg |
|
Flow rate |
30L/min |
|
Collection jars |
1 x 2L |
|
Dimensions H x W x D cm |
38 x 45 x 20 |
|
Weight |
10kg |
|
Noise level |
65dB |
